CockroachDB Script Tablosu (Dağıtık SQL – ACID)

İMRAN

Archive Forum Kurucu
Admin
Katılım
10 Nisan 2025
Mesajlar
1,654
Çözümler
1
Reaksiyon puanı
139
Konum
Türkiye

CockroachDB Script Tablosu (Dağıtık SQL – ACID)

Komut / ScriptAçıklamaKullanım AlanıAvantajlarRiskler
CREATE DATABASE app;Yeni DB oluştururCluster yapısıTam ACID uyumluYanlış cluster konfig. performansı düşürür
SET database = app;Kullanılacak DB seçilirQuery yönetimiKolayYanlış DB’de işlem
CREATE TABLE users (...);Tablo oluştururDağıtık SQLOtomatik replikasyonYanlış primary key shard problemleri
INSERT INTO users VALUES(...);Veri eklerTransactionYük altında bile stabilYüksek write varsa node yoğunluğu
UPSERT INTO users VALUES(...);Yoksa ekler, varsa güncellerConflict çözümüÇakışma sorunlarını çözerYanlış unique key yapılandırması
ALTER TABLE ... SPLIT AT ...Partition ayırmaShardingPerformans artışıYanlış bölme → düzensiz shard
BACKUP TO 'nodelocal://1/backup';Yedek almaFelaket kurtarmaÇok güçlüDepolama dolabilir
RESTORE FROM 'nodelocal://1/backup';Geri yüklemeCluster recoveryDağıtık şekilde yüklenirYanlış restore tüm cluster’ı etkiler
SHOW RANGES FROM TABLE users;Shard’ları gösterirDağıtık yapı analiziCluster optimizasyonYanlış range yönetimi performansı etkiler
EXPLAIN ANALYZESorgu planını gösterirOptimizasyonNet analizYoğun sorguda yavaş
 
Geri
Üst Alt